Original Description
Vilhelm Karl Ferdinand Arnesen’s Sejlskib Pa Abent Hav, I Baggrunden Tre Skibe ("Sailboat on Open Sea, Three Ships in the Background") captures the romanticism of 19th-century maritime art with remarkable atmospheric depth. Painted during Scandinavia’s Golden Age of marine painting, Arnesen’s work reflects his Danish-Norwegian heritage and technical mastery of seascapes—balancing realism with lyrical light effects reminiscent of J.C. Dahl’s traditions. The composition thrums with energy: a lone sailboat battles choppy turquoise waves while distant ships blur into the horizon, their billowing sails kissed by a diffused golden glow. This interplay of dynamism and tranquility epitomizes Nordic artists’ fascination with man’s symbiotic struggle against nature. Though less internationally prominent than his contemporary Peder Balke, Arnesen’s works remain pivotal in documenting Norway’s coastal identity during the post-industrial era, bridging Romantic emotionality with emerging plein-air precision.
